ABSTRACT:
An address sequencer and memory arrangement is shown for transferring data in the form of message bytes to and from a plurality of digital data links. The address sequencer and memory arrangement includes a memory circuit having a plurality of memory location areas associated with each of the plurality of digital data links. A counter circuit connected to the memory circuit is loaded with a preset count by a link processor complex. The counter increments and outputs to the memory circuit addresses which sequentially access each of the memory location areas, transferring each message byte to a data link output buffer for transmission over a respective one of the plurality of digital data links. Alternatively, the counter addresses sequentially each memory location area transferring a message byte to each memory location area from each of the plurality of digital data links via a data link input buffer.
